Interactive Video

H5P - Interactive Video - Inconsistent timings of questions

Basic details
Type of device: Desktop
Browser: Chrome
Platform: Moodle

H5P plugin version: Built-in Moodle H5P plugin
H5P, mod_h5pactivity, 2021051700
H5P, contenttype_h5p, 2021051700
H5P framework v1.24, h5plib_v124, 2021051700

H5P content type and version: Interactive Video (and I see two lines in Moodle H5P content types area, and two different versions: 1.22.14, 1.24.4, although I didn't change anything in this area of the system, so I hope it's normal)

"The Vimeo video could not be loaded." error in Safari in case you limit your video embedding to specified domains

Related content type: Interactive video

Steps to reproduce:

You'll need a vimeo premium or business account.

Upload a video to vimeo and change "Embed (Where can the video be embedded?)" field to: "Specific domains" and specify your domain.

Embed this video on your website (our website using Drupal 7 version of H5P module - 7.x-1.50 ) into an interactive video type h5p content.

Open your page in Safari browser (both OSX Safari and iOS Safari affected).

You will get "The Vimeo video could not be loaded." error.

Simplest way to implement timed decisions for branch navigation

Hello everyone, thank you for working on such a capable package and distributing it for free! I am developing a branching storyline for a set of safety training videos. They are quite simple trees where every video ends in two children. The client would like the decision points to have a countdown effect, much like the Netflix interactive videos such as You vs. Wild (https://youtu.be/pwcr3cc0LZM?t=13).

I would like to have the following specifications:

Pages